A client asks the nurse what surfactant is. which explanation would the nurse give as the main role of surfactant in the neonate?

Respuesta :

meerkat18
meerkat18 meerkat18
  • 26-01-2018
The role of surfactant in neonate is it reduced the surface tension of lung fluids and makes alveoli more stable.
